为了克服内调制时伴生调幅现象对相位生成载波解调结果的影响,提出了一种相位生成载波解调改进算法。通过利用干涉信号中的三次谐波分量和基频分量进行解调,有效地消除了伴生调幅对解调结果的影响。改进后的算法减少了一路混频信号的产生,降低了数字解调时占用的内存及系统的采样频率。给出了改进算法的Matlab仿真和CCS硬件仿真实验结果,分析验证了算法的可行性。
In order to overcome the effect of the accompanying amplitude modulation on the demodulation results of the phase-generated carrier during intra-mode modulation, an improved demodulation algorithm of phase-generated carrier is proposed. By using the third harmonic component and the fundamental frequency component of the interference signal for demodulation, the effect of the associated amplitude modulation on the demodulation result is effectively eliminated. The improved algorithm reduces the generation of mixed signals and reduces the memory and system sampling frequency in digital demodulation. The improved Matlab simulation and CCS hardware simulation results are given, and the feasibility of the algorithm is verified.
